没有合适的资源?快使用搜索试试~ 我知道了~
首页Professional JavaScript Frameworks Prototype, YUI, Ext JS, Dojo and MooTools.pdf
Professional JavaScript Frameworks Prototype, YUI, Ext JS, Dojo ...

This book is for web developers who want to get straight into JavaScript and explore the tools and productivity gains offered by the frameworks. A working knowledge of HTML, CSS, and JavaScript are assumed — and also of use will be some experience with object-oriented programming, server-side PHP scripting, and knowledge of web development modern techniques such as AJAX.
资源详情
资源评论
资源推荐

www.wrox.com
$49.99 USA
$59.99 CANADA
Wrox Professional guides are planned and written by working programmers to meet the real-world needs of programmers,
developers, and IT professionals. Focused and relevant, they address the issues technology professionals face every day. They
provide examples, practical solutions, and expert education in new technologies, all designed to help programmers do a better job.
Recommended
Computer Book
Categories
Web Development
JavaScript
ISBN: 978-0-470-38459-6
As the needs and demands of developers have evolved over
the years, so has JavaScript, which boasts a track record
of delivering high-performing and exceptionally impressive
web-user experiences. This flexible, dynamic programming
language is increasingly used for serious development on the
web, and several of its tools and projects are being shared in
the form of libraries and frameworks. Packed with coverage
of many of the most popular JavaScript frameworks, this
authoritative guide examines how these frameworks can
present unique and varying approaches to a variety of
problems in web development—each of which has its own
pros and cons.
This unparalleled team of authors has assembled some of
the most active and popular JavaScript frameworks available
and they walk you through common web development tasks
addressed by each framework, while also examining how the
framework approaches a particular set of tasks. In addition,
practical examples and clear explanations demonstrate the
many aspects of contemporary web development and exactly
what the selection of JavaScript frameworks has to offer so
that you can get up and running quickly.
What you will learn from this book
● The Prototype framework: handling cross-browser events,
manipulating common data functions, simplifying AJAX
and dynamic data, and more
● Yahoo! User Interface (YUI) library: using animation and
drag and drop, building user interfaces with widgets,
working with YUI CSS tools, and more
● Ext JS framework: talking with the server, using dataviews
and grids, dealing with form controls and validation, and
more
● The Dojo framework: manipulating the DOM, composing
animators, deploying and expanding Dojo, and more
● The MooTools framework: enhancing development with
MooTools, building user interfaces and using animation,
and more
Who this book is for
This book is for web developers who are eager to explore the
benefits of JavaScript frameworks. A working knowledge of
HTML, CSS, and JavaScript is required.
Orchard
Pehlivanian
Koon
Jones
spine=1.734"
Updates, source code, and Wrox technical support at www.wrox.com
Leslie M. Orchard, Ara Pehlivanian, Scott Koon, Harley Jones
Professional
Professional
JavaScript
®
Frameworks
Prototype, YUI, Ext JS,
Dojo and MooTools
JavaScript
®
Frameworks
Prototype, YUI, Ext JS, Dojo and MooTools
JavaScript
®
Frameworks
Prototype, YUI, Ext JS, Dojo and MooTools
Professional
Wrox Programmer to Programmer
TM
Wrox Programmer to Programmer
TM

spine=1.734"
Get more out of
WROX.com
Programmer to Programmer
™
Interact
Take an active role online by participating in
our P2P forums
Wrox Online Library
Hundreds of our books are available online
through Books24x7.com
Wrox Blox
Download short informational pieces and
code to keep you up to date and out of
trouble!
Chapters on Demand
Purchase individual book chapters in pdf
format
Join the Community
Sign up for our free monthly newsletter at
newsletter.wrox.com
Browse
Ready for more Wrox? We have books and
e-books available on .NET, SQL Server, Java,
XML, Visual Basic, C#/ C++, and much more!
Contact Us.
We always like to get feedback from our readers. Have a book idea?
Need community support? Let us know by e-mailing wrox-partnerwithus@wrox.com

Professional JavaScript® Frameworks
Introduction ............................................................................................... xxv
Part I: Prototype 1
Chapter 1: Extending and Enhancing DOM Elements ........................................3
Chapter 2: Handling Cross-Browser Events ....................................................23
Chapter 3: Simplifying AJAX and Dynamic Data .............................................33
Chapter 4: Working with Forms .....................................................................43
Chapter 5: Manipulating Common Data Structures and Functions ..................53
Chapter 6: Extending Prototype ....................................................................71
Part II: Yahoo! User Interface Library 89
Chapter 7: Traversing and Manipulating the DOM with YUI .............................93
Chapter 8: Handling Cross-Browser Events ..................................................113
Chapter 9: Using Animation and Drag and Drop .......................................... 147
Chapter 10: Simplifying AJAX and Dynamic Loading .................................... 173
Chapter 11: Building User Interfaces with Widgets (Part I) ......................... 189
Chapter 12: Building User Interfaces with Widgets (Part II) ........................ 225
Chapter 13: Enhancing Development with the YUI Core .............................. 269
Chapter 14: Dealing with Data, Tables, and Charts ..................................... 291
Chapter 15: Working with YUI CSS Tools .................................................... 317
Chapter 16: Building and Deploying ............................................................ 329
Part III: Ext JS 335
Chapter 17: Architecture and Library Conventions ...................................... 337
Chapter 18: Elements, DomHelper, and Templates ...................................... 351
Continued
ffirs.indd iffirs.indd i 7/22/09 10:05:31 AM7/22/09 10:05:31 AM

Chapter 19: Components, Layouts, and Windows ........................................ 373
Chapter 20: Handling Data and Talking with the Server ............................... 395
Chapter 21: DataViews and Grids ............................................................... 415
Chapter 22: Form Controls, Validation, and a Whole Lot More ..................... 431
Part IV: Dojo 451
Chapter 23: Enhancing Development with Dojo Core ....................................453
Chapter 24: Manipulating the Dom ..............................................................473
Chapter 25: Handling Events .......................................................................499
Chapter 26: Composing Animations ............................................................525
Chapter 27: Working with Ajax and Dynamic Data .......................................547
Chapter 28: Building User Interfaces with Widgets ......................................595
Chapter 29: Building and Deploying Dojo .....................................................655
Chapter 30: Expanding Dojo ........................................................................663
Part V: MooTools 689
Chapter 31: Enhancing Development with MooTools ....................................691
Chapter 32: Manipulating the Dom and Handling Events ..............................725
Chapter 33: Simplifying Ajax and Handling Dynamic Data .............................763
Chapter 34: Building User Interfaces and Using Animation ...........................787
Index .........................................................................................................835
ffirs.indd iiffirs.indd ii 7/22/09 10:05:32 AM7/22/09 10:05:32 AM

Professional
JavaScript® Frameworks
Prototype, YUI, Ext JS, Dojo and MooTools
Leslie Michael Orchard
Ara Pehlivanian
Scott Koon
Harley Jones
Wiley Publishing, Inc.
ffirs.indd iiiffirs.indd iii 7/22/09 10:05:32 AM7/22/09 10:05:32 AM
剩余890页未读,继续阅读

















安全验证
文档复制为VIP权益,开通VIP直接复制

评论1